Eligible residents needing emergency furnace reconnection or households with children younger than 5 can now enroll for assistance through the Community Economic and Development Association of Cook County.

The non-profit, which provides programs and services for residents in need, opened enrollment for the winter heating season program Oct. 1. Seniors and individuals with disabilities can apply for assistance right now, too, as enrollment began for them Sept. 4. General enrollment will start Nov. 1.
